Joey Abell W10 Teke Oruh... In the ShoBox main event from the island of St. Lucia, late sub Joey Abell won a majority decision over Teke Oruh by scores of 95-95, 96-94 and a too-wide 98-92. Abell looked completely unsure of himself but came on late in the uninspring heavyweight fight to claim the win. Given that Abell came in with 17 KO wins in a 17-1 career, it was confusing to see him fight so passively, but he did show some ability. Still, he is a work in progress. The Nigerian Oruh, now 14-1-1, didn't fight with enough fire and the loss represents a setback for him. source: shobox on showtime
